Mizoram Govt to promote weavers: Minister

By Newmai News

AIZAWL, July 10 - Mizoram Industries Minister H Rohluna said that the State Government plans to further promote weavers in the State and continue to support them. He was speaking at a function in Kawlkulh Handloom Cluster on Thursday.

The Minister said that Cluster Development Programme has been carried out at 17 different places in the State and Kawlkulh Cluster was one.

He distributed Rs 26,000 each to the 90 successful trainees for construction of work shed and expressed his hope that the same would generate a new source of income for Kawlkulh and surrounding areas.

In order that the weavers may easily purchase yarn the government has arranged Weavers� Credit Card scheme under which banks gives out loan upto Rs 3 lakh at a low rate of interest of 3 per cent only, the Minister said.

The total assistance to be received by Mizoram for Cluster Development Programme is Rs 16.44 crore of which Rs 9.07 crore has been received. Under Integrated Skill Development Scheme (ISDS), Mizoram would receive Rs 1.12 crore.
